目的 探讨星形细胞瘤中Bcl -2和Bax蛋白表达与其恶性程度的关系。方法 用免疫组织化学法和原位缺口末端标记 (TUNEL)法分别检测 10例正常脑组织和 80例经病理证实的不同恶性程度的星形细胞瘤中Bcl-2、Bax蛋白表达阳性率和凋亡细胞百分率。结果 正常脑组织中未见Bcl -2和Bax蛋白阳性表达 ,且凋亡细胞百分率仅为 (0 6± 0 1) % ;不同恶性程度的星形细胞瘤间Bcl-2、Bax蛋白表达阳性率和凋亡细胞百分率的差异有显著性 (P <0 0 5 ) ,且随着恶性程度的增高 ,Bcl -2蛋白表达阳性率有降低的趋势 ,而Bax蛋白表达阳性率和凋亡细胞百分率均有升高的趋势。相关分析显示 ,星形细胞瘤的恶性程度与Bax蛋白表达阳性率和凋亡细胞百分率呈正相关 (r =0 90 1,P <0 0 5 ) ,而与Bcl-2蛋白表达阳性率呈负相关 (r =-0 93 2 ,P <0 0 5 )。结论 Bcl -2、Bax蛋白表达阳性率和凋亡细胞百分率可能与星形细胞瘤的恶性程度有关
Objective To investigate the relationship between the expression of Bcl-2 and Bax proteins and their malignancy in astrocytomas. Methods Immunohistochemistry and TUNEL were used to detect the positive rate of Bcl-2 and Bax protein in 10 normal brain tissue and 80 pathologically confirmed astrocytomas Dead cell percentage. Results There was no positive expression of Bcl-2 and Bax in normal brain tissue, and the percentage of apoptotic cells was only (0 6 ± 0 1)%. The positive rate of Bcl-2 and Bax expression in astrocytomas with different malignancy (P <0.05), and the positive rate of Bcl-2 protein decreased with the increase of the degree of malignancy, while the positive rate of Bax protein and percentage of apoptotic cells There is an increasing trend. Correlation analysis showed that the malignant degree of astrocytoma was positively correlated with the positive rate of Bax protein and the percentage of apoptotic cells (r = 0 901, P <0 05), but negatively correlated with the positive rate of Bcl-2 protein (r = -0 93 2, P <0 0 5). Conclusion The positive rate of Bcl-2 and Bax protein and the percentage of apoptotic cells may be related to the malignancy of astrocytomas
